Real Estate Market
The real estate market in Heritage is characterized by high-value homes, with a median home value of $1,300,000. Properties spend an average of 44 days on the market, and the price per square foot is approximately $804. This indicates a stable and desirable market for homeowners.

Transportation & Connectivity
Heritage benefits from excellent connectivity via major roadways like MoPac Expressway and US-183. This provides straightforward commutes to downtown Austin, the Domain, and Austin-Bergstrom International Airport. Public transit options are also available through Capital Metro's bus services.
